Hi. Whenever I try to load my save, I get a message telling me to send a message to paradox about the game crash. I don't know why the game crashes, either I don't have enough memory (it's possible), or the mods are broken or incompatible. I hope you can help.
 
91% memory in use.
8063 MB physical memory [683 MB free].
25577 MB paging file [0 MB free].

As you pointed out, yes, you've run out of available memory. With only 8GB of RAM, you have the bare minimum to run the game, so I'd advise you to unsubscribe from all mods/assets you're subscribed to and also close other apps that might be running in the background while playing the game. If that still doesn't work, come back here with the new crash report please.
